Description:

Luteolin-7-O-D-glucopyranoside is a natural compound that has been shown to have hypoglycemic properties. It is a glucoside of the flavonoid luteolin and has been shown to have an inhibitory effect on the activities of enzymes such as α-amylase, lipase, and phospholipase A2. Luteolin-7-O-D-glucopyranoside also prevents oxidative injury caused by reactive oxygen species (ROS) in cells. In addition, it has been shown to be effective against infectious diseases, such as leishmaniasis and tuberculosis. It is believed that luteolin-7-O-D-glucopyranoside may work by acting as a proapoptotic protein. This compound binds to the mitochondria membrane and causes increased permeability of the mitochondrial membrane for cytochrome c, leading to apoptosis.
